Job Posting
The Bus Driver is responsible for the operations of various types of buses that will transport students and other passengers to and from designated locations. Drivers typically work without direct supervision and are fully responsible for the safety of their passengers. When not required to drive for IWCC, FT Bus Drivers assist the IWCC maintenance department under the supervision of the Maintenance Supervisor.
Job Duties :
- Demonstrate IWCC's core mission, vision and values
- Transport students and other passengers to and from designated destinations, overnights and weekends, adjust and plan travel routes if necessary
- Make routine checks and inspection of bus and equipment for proper operation, safety, and maintenance
- Observe and follow all applicable federal, state, local laws, and regulations governing commercial transportation
- Follow school district guidelines regarding student management and discipline; report incidents to proper personnel
- Maintain required records of bus usage and reports of operation
- Drive commercial transportation vehicles with airbrakes
- Perform minor maintenance and safety checks of commercial vehicles
- Perform a wide range of non-technical maintenance
- Maintaining grounds and grounds equipment
- Ability to do tasks as assigned in an efficient and timely manner with little supervision
- Ensures proper care in the use and maintenance of equipment and supplies; promotes continuous improvement of workplace safety and environmental practices
- Monitors and performs non-technical standard repairs to building electrical facilities and systems, such as bulbs, fixtures, switches, photo cells, and outlets; assists licensed electricians as appropriate
- Monitors and performs non-technical maintenance of plumbing systems, to include standard repair of leaking fixtures, cleaning obstructed waste lines, and / or performing non-technical modifications to plumbing and water supply systems; assists licensed plumbers, as appropriate
- Performs carpentry maintenance tasks including routine sheetrock / drywall installation and / or repair, window replacement, cabinet and countertop replacement, painting and texturing, and door and hardware installation; paints interior and exterior finishes, as appropriate
- Performs snow removal, as needed
